    Ute Trays (not tubs)

    Hi Gents and Ladies,

    Does anyone know if there are ADRs or VSBs applying to after market ute tray specs?

    And, are there any rules specifically relating to overhang aft of the rear axle and overall width?

    Perhaps is it some ratio relating to wheelbase?

    Anyhow, if someone could point me in the direction of finding out something definite I would appreciate it.

    (Obviously too much overhang would be disastrous for handling if it was improperly loaded and I'm guessing that there may be a safety issue for following vehicles in regard to potential rear end collisions)

    Hi,
    Tas is 60% of the wheelbase length is the allowed max distance behind the rear axle.

    Not sure on overall width, but 6ft wide x 8ft is a standard size, on a 130 you can get another 40cm in length if you want it, but 9ft is about as far as I would go.
